Software Engineer Intern
2 weeks ago
Job Description
You will be responsible for:
Designing and implementing Java-based applications.
Analyzing user requirements to inform application design.
Debugging and resolving technical problems that arise.
Ensuring continuous professional self-development.
Basic Requirements
Please note this is a hybrid role based out of the Edinburgh Office.
Basic Requirements
What you bring to the table:
Bachelor’s degree in computer science, information technology, or equivalent experience.
At least 2+ years of experience in building large-scale Java software applications.
Substantial understanding of object-oriented programming and design patterns.
Knowledge of testing and debugging software issues.
Good understanding of relational databases, ORM Technologies, and SQL.
Collaborates with co-workers and has strong communication, relationship-building, and cooperation skills.
Bonus points for:
Experience with microservices architecture/distributed computing (Docker, Podman).
Knowledge of frontend languages (JavaScript, HTML, CSS) and their libraries.
Previous working experience in an Agile environment (Scrum).
Familiarity with Linux-based environments.
In return for your expertise, we’ll support you in this new challenge with coaching & development every step of the way -
If you like innovating and self development, We're offering a fantastic extra benefit - '10% time' - which means you can spend 10% of your working hours exclusively on personal and professional growth. From LinkedIn Learning to passion projects - anything, provided it helps build your skills and knowledge.
Along with our '10% time' benefit you'll also be rewarded with:
Competitive salary and bonus schemes.
Two weeks additional pay per year (holiday bonus).
25 days holiday entitlement + bank holidays. • Attractive defined contribution pension scheme.
Employee stock purchase plan.
Flexible working options.
Private medical care.
Life assurance.
Enhanced maternity and paternity pay.
Career development support and wide ranging learning opportunities.
Employee health and wellbeing support EAP, wellbeing guidance etc.
Carbon neutral initiatives/goals.
Corporate social responsibility initiatives including support for volunteering days.
Well known companies discount scheme.
'We are an equal opportunities employer and we want you to have every opportunity to shine and show us your talents, please let us know if there is anything we can do to make sure the process works for you. We celebrate diversity and are committed to creating an inclusive environment for all employees.’
CONNECT WITH A CAREER THAT MATTERS
We’re dedicated to designing and delivering the mission-critical ecosystem our public safety & enterprise customers refer to as their lifeline – mission-critical communications, software, video and services. Our drive for continuous innovation and partnership with our customers enables them to be ready – in the day-to-day moments, and in the moments that matter most.
#LI-AR1
Travel Requirements
Relocation Provided
Position Type
Referral Payment Plan
Yes
Company
Motorola Solutions UK LimitedEEO Statement
Motorola Solutions is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ion or belief, sex, sexual orientation, gender identity, national origin, disability, veteran status or any other legally-protected characteristic.
We are proud of our people-first and community-focused culture, empowering every Motorolan to be their most authentic self and to do their best work to deliver on the promise of a safer world. If you’d like to join our team but feel that you don’t quite meet all of the preferred skills, we’d still love to hear why you think you’d be a great addition to our team.
We’re committed to providing an inclusive and accessible recruiting experience for candidates with disabilities, or other physical or mental health conditions. To request an accommodation, please email
-
Intern Software Engineer
6 months ago
Edinburgh, United Kingdom KAL Full timeYour opportunity This is an exciting, year-round opportunity for aspiring Software Engineers who are currently pursuing a degree in Informatics, Computer Science or other relevant to software development discipline. As an intern at KAL, you will work in collaboration with and under the guidance of other members of our Engineering team. Over a period...
-
Software Engineering Intern
5 months ago
Edinburgh, United Kingdom AMETEK, Inc. Full timeThe Software Engineering Intern role will experience Embedded and GNU/LinuxSystem software Development on a selection of projects based in Abaco’s Networking Innovation Centre in Edinburgh. This is a 12 month internship that is specifically designed/geared towards applicants who should be studying towards a relevant sandwich degree that recognises a 12...
-
Software Development Intern
4 weeks ago
Edinburgh, Edinburgh, United Kingdom KAL Full timeYour Career OpportunityKAL is seeking a talented and ambitious individual to join our Engineering team as a Software Development Intern. This exciting opportunity will provide you with a practical insight into the business and valuable experience in software engineering to support your studies.As an intern, you will work collaboratively with our experienced...
-
Software Developer Intern
5 months ago
Edinburgh, United Kingdom UserTesting Full timeWe're UserTesting, a leader in experience research and insights; we believe the path to human understanding and great experiences start with a shared understanding—seeing and hearing how another person engages with the world around them and taking in their perspective. Working at UserTesting, you will be empowered to help organizations discover the human...
-
Software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Choice Consultants Full timeKey Responsibilities:• Develop software applications using programming languages such as Java, Python, and C++.• Collaborate with cross-functional teams to identify and prioritize software development projects.• Design and implement software solutions that meet business requirements and are scalable, efficient, and reliable.• Troubleshoot and resolve...
-
Software Engineer
1 month ago
Edinburgh, Edinburgh, United Kingdom Head Resourcing Full timeJob Description: As a Software Engineer - Ground Software Developer at Head Resourcing, you will be working closely with an Aerospace client to find a commercially experienced, mid-level Java Developer with some commercial experience in Java or Python. This role offers an exciting opportunity to contribute to the ongoing development of the ground software...
-
Software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Lloyds Banking Group Full timeAbout this opportunityIn the Payments Services Platform (PSP), our mission is to provide compliant and efficient domestic and international payments capabilities for the Group and drive innovation to enable customers to move money confidently, quickly and securely.This role is in the Enterprise & Accounting Lab within the Payments Platform and specifically...
-
Software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om ABM UK Full timeJob Title: Software EngineerAbout the Role:We are seeking a sk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for designing, developing, and testing software applications.Key Responsibilities:• Design and develop software applications• Collaborate with cross-functional teams• Test and debug software...
-
Software Engineer
6 days ago
Edinburgh, Edinburgh, United Kingdom Cathcart Technology Full timeCathcart Technology, an R&D focused Tech organisation based in Edinburgh, is going through a period of growth and is looking for an experienced Software Engineer to join their hybrid team. This role offers really flexible working and lots of autonomy on offer.The company is taking high-precision lab technology and making it accessible and practical for...
-
Software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Communisis Full timeAre you passionate about building software solutions that meet the needs of our company and customers?We have an exciting opportunity for a skilled software engineer to join our team.Responsibilities include developing high-quality software products and collaborating with our talented team of developers.As a software engineer, you will be working with a...
-
Senior Software Engineer Leader
2 weeks ago
Edinburgh, Edinburgh, United Kingdom Bright Purple Full timeUnlock Your Potential as a Senior Software Engineer LeaderBright Purple is seeking an exceptional Senior Software Engineer Leader to drive innovation and shape the digital landscape of our organisation.About UsWe are a leading international organisation valued for our expertise, offering autonomy to develop innovative projects and fostering a culture that...
-
Software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om NHS Scotland Full timeJob Title: Software EngineerAbout the Role:We are seeking a skilled Software Engineer to join our team.Key Responsibilities:Design, develop, and test software applicationsCollaborate with cross-functional teams to deliver high-quality software solutions
-
Senior Software Engineering Lead
3 weeks ago
Edinburgh, Edinburgh, United Kingdom Lloyds Bank plc Full timeAbout this opportunityOur TeamOur Cash Management & Payments Platform, Core Banking & Payment Lab teams are focused on delivering high-quality software. We're seeking a skilled Software Engineer to join our team, working closely with Product and other Engineering teams to create, build, support, and improve our software.The RoleAs a Software Engineer, you'll...
-
Intern Edinburgh
5 months ago
Edinburgh, United Kingdom Shure Full timeOverview: At Shure we offer internships within different engineering disciplines, and we are keen to speak to talented students, who are passionate about engineering. As an intern at Shure, you will be part of the professional team of Software developers and engineers who are passionate about our products, technologies, innovation, and product quality. Our...
-
Software Engineer
4 weeks ago
Edinburgh, Edinburgh, United Kingdom Leonardo Full timeWe are looking for a Software Engineer who will be responsible for the development of our backend systems. The ideal candidate will have a strong understanding of Java and cloud computing and will be able to work effectively in a team environment.The Software Engineer will be responsible for designing, developing, testing, and deploying scalable and secure...
-
Java Software Engineer
1 month ago
Edinburgh, United Kingdom Head Resourcing Full timeJava Developer Sponsorship support is not available sadly.I am working closely with an Aerospace client to find a commercially experienced, mid level Java Developer with some commercial experience in Java or Python.As part of this team, you will be at the forefront of developing cutting-edge spacecraft ground software and software tools. This role offers an...
-
Java Software Engineer
1 month ago
Edinburgh, United Kingdom Head Resourcing Full timeJava Developer Sponsorship support is not available sadly. I am working closely with an Aerospace client to find a commercially experienced, mid level Java Developer with some commercial experience in Java or Python. As part of this team, you will be at the forefront of developing cutting-edge spacecraft ground software and software tools. This role offers...
-
Java Software Engineer
1 month ago
Edinburgh, United Kingdom Head Resourcing Full timeJava Developer Sponsorship support is not available sadly.I am working closely with an Aerospace client to find a commercially experienced, mid level Java Developer with some commercial experience in Java or Python.As part of this team, you will be at the forefront of developing cutting-edge spacecraft ground software and software tools. This role offers an...
-
Java Software Engineer
1 month ago
Edinburgh, United Kingdom Head Resourcing Full timeJava Developer Sponsorship support is not available sadly.I am working closely with an Aerospace client to find a commercially experienced, mid level Java Developer with some commercial experience in Java or Python.As part of this team, you will be at the forefront of developing cutting-edge spacecraft ground software and software tools. This role offers an...
-
Java Software Engineer
1 month ago
Edinburgh, United Kingdom Head Resourcing Full timeJava Developer Sponsorship support is not available sadly. I am working closely with an Aerospace client to find a commercially experienced, mid level Java Developer with some commercial experience in Java or Python. As part of this team, you will be at the forefront of developing cutting-edge spacecraft ground software and software tools. This role...